Cyclopropanation reactions of pyroglutamic acid-derived synthons with akylidene transfer reagents
Zhang, Rui,Mamai, Ahmed,Madalengoitia, Jose S.
, p. 547 - 555 (1999)
The cyclopropanation of unsaturated lactams 1 and 3 derived from pyroglutamic acid with nucleophilic alkylidene transfer reagents is investigated. Good-to-modest yields of cyclopropanes were obtained with most sulfur ylides explored. Syn/anti selectivity was found to be dependent on the synthon as well as the sulfur ylide. This cyclopropanation methodology is used in the synthesis of arginine and glutamic acid analogues.
